Transaction c7945f2de5f9120f40d903fef1ded4eff40257c16aecac01d27c38f2f0d253ab
1 Input
1 Outputs
- c7945f2de5f9120f40d903fef1ded4eff40257c16aecac01d27c38f2f0d253ab:0
value 1408031
address 37d71u4GKuR32JJCPBPsWNw6No9SfNWr8N